Mrs Sultana Boulos (née Rizq)
Mrs Joseph Boulos (Sultana), 40, from Lebanon, boarded the Titanic at Cherbourg as a third class passenger (ticket number 2678, £15, 4s, 11d). She was travelling to Kent, Ontario with her two children Nourelain and Akar.
Mrs Boulos lost her life in the disaster. Her body, if recovered, was never identified.
